Understanding Debt-to-Equity Ratio

The debt-to-equity (D/E) ratio measures a company's financial leverage by comparing total liabilities to shareholders' equity. It shows how much debt a company uses to finance its operations relative to the value owned by shareholders.

A D/E of 1.0 means equal amounts of debt and equity. Higher ratios indicate more debt financing, which can amplify returns but also increases financial risk. Lower ratios suggest conservative financing with more equity.

This ratio is crucial for investors assessing risk, lenders evaluating creditworthiness, and management making capital structure decisions. It varies widely by industry—capital-intensive sectors typically carry more debt.

Risk Levels by D/E Ratio

🟢

D/E < 0.5

Conservative. Low leverage, financially stable, but may miss growth opportunities.

🟡

D/E 0.5 - 1.0

Moderate. Balanced leverage. Common for established companies.

🟠

D/E 1.0 - 2.0

Aggressive. Higher returns possible but increased financial risk.

🔴

D/E > 2.0

High risk. Heavy debt burden. Vulnerable to interest rate changes and downturns.

Industry D/E Benchmarks

IndustryTypical D/EWhyNotes
Utilities1.0 - 2.0Capital intensiveStable cash flows
Real Estate1.5 - 3.0Asset-backedProperty collateral
Technology0.1 - 0.5Asset-lightOften cash-rich
Banking5.0 - 15.0Business modelDeposits = liabilities
Retail0.5 - 1.5Inventory financingVaries widely

Tips for D/E Analysis

🏭

Consider Industry

Capital-intensive industries (utilities, manufacturing) naturally carry more debt. Compare within sectors.

📅

Check Debt Maturity

Long-term debt is less risky than short-term. A company may have high D/E but manageable if debt is long-dated.

💰

Interest Coverage

High D/E is less concerning if the company easily covers interest payments. Check interest coverage ratio.

📉

Economic Cycle

High leverage is riskier in recessions. Companies with high D/E may face solvency issues in downturns.

Examples

Conservative: low-leverage tech company

A profitable software company has $500,000 in total liabilities and $1,000,000 in shareholders' equity. The CFO wants to confirm the balance sheet is conservatively financed before issuing new shares.

ResultD/E ratio of 0.50, equity multiplier of 1.50x, and debt ratio of 33.3%. The calculator classifies this as Moderate risk — typical for asset-light tech firms.

Dividing $500,000 by $1,000,000 gives a D/E of 0.5, meaning the company has 50 cents of debt for every dollar of equity. The equity multiplier (1 + 0.5 = 1.5) shows assets are 1.5 times equity. For a software business, this is well within the 0.1–0.5 benchmark range from NYU Stern data.

Aggressive: leveraged real estate firm

A commercial real estate operator carries $2,000,000 of mortgage debt against $500,000 of equity. Investors want to know whether leverage is reasonable for the sector.

ResultD/E ratio of 4.00, equity multiplier of 5.00x, debt ratio of 80%. Flagged as High Risk by the widget, but acceptable inside real estate where 1.5–3.0 is common and 4.0 is borderline.

$2,000,000 ÷ $500,000 = 4.0. Every dollar of equity supports four dollars of debt, so a 25% drop in property values would wipe out equity entirely. Real estate tolerates higher D/E because properties generate predictable rent and serve as collateral, but lenders generally want debt service coverage above 1.25x before underwriting at this level.

Edge case: bank with deposit liabilities

A community bank reports $8,000,000 in total liabilities (mostly customer deposits) and $1,000,000 in equity. An analyst wants to compare it to non-bank peers and avoid a misleading red flag.

ResultD/E ratio of 8.00, equity multiplier of 9.00x, debt ratio of 88.9%. The widget marks High Risk, but for banking this falls inside the typical 5–15 range.

Banks are required by their business model to hold large liabilities — deposits ARE the funding source for loans. The Federal Reserve's bank holding company data shows median D/E of 8–10. The right comparison is to other banks and to regulatory capital ratios (Tier 1, CET1), not to non-financial firms.

How it works

The calculator divides total liabilities by shareholders' equity to produce D/E=Total LiabilitiesShareholders’ EquityD/E = \frac{\text{Total Liabilities}}{\text{Shareholders' Equity}}. A result of 1.0 means equal debt and equity financing; 0.5 means twice as much equity as debt; 2.0 means twice as much debt as equity.

When you provide Total Assets, the widget also computes the debt ratio (Total Debt ÷ Total Assets) and the equity multiplier (Total Assets ÷ Equity, equivalent to 1 + D/E). If you leave Total Assets blank, it assumes the accounting identity Assets = Liabilities + Equity, which holds on a clean balance sheet.

The qualitative risk label is a heuristic: under 0.5 is Conservative, 0.5–1.0 Moderate, 1.0–2.0 Aggressive, and above 2.0 High Risk. These thresholds suit non-financial corporate use. For utilities, real estate, or banks, raise the threshold by the industry norm — what counts as conservative in real estate would be reckless for a software firm.

Equity here is book equity from the balance sheet. Analysts who care about market signals sometimes recompute D/E with market capitalization in the denominator, which gives a different — often lower — reading for healthy public companies because market value typically exceeds book value.

When to use this calculator

  • Stock screening. Filter equity research candidates by capital structure. Pair D/E with interest coverage and return on equity to find companies whose leverage is generating returns rather than just risk.
  • Credit underwriting. Lenders and bond analysts check D/E to set covenants and price risk. Many bank covenants require D/E below a stated ceiling, so the ratio doubles as a compliance metric.
  • M&A diligence. Acquirers model pro-forma D/E after the deal to ensure the combined company stays within investment-grade ratios and avoids credit downgrades.
  • Capital structure planning. CFOs use D/E to weigh debt issuance, share buybacks, or equity raises. Boards often set target ratios as part of the company's financial policy.
  • Peer benchmarking. Compare a company to its industry median using SEC EDGAR filings or NYU Damodaran's industry data. A D/E that's far above or below peers warrants a closer look.

Common mistakes

  • MistakeComparing D/E across different industries.
    FixA 2.0 ratio is alarming for a software firm but routine for a utility. Always benchmark against direct industry peers using SEC filings or Damodaran's industry datasets.
  • MistakeUsing only long-term debt in the numerator.
    FixThe classic D/E uses total liabilities, including accounts payable and short-term borrowings. If you exclude them, label the variant clearly (e.g., 'long-term D/E') so you don't mislead readers comparing your number to standard databases.
  • MistakeIgnoring off-balance-sheet liabilities.
    FixOperating leases, pension shortfalls, and contingent obligations can be material. Under ASC 842 most leases now appear on the balance sheet, but older filings and certain commitments may not — read the footnotes.
  • MistakeTreating negative equity as a low ratio.
    FixIf retained losses have wiped out equity, D/E becomes negative or undefined — not low. The widget will reject zero equity; for negative equity, the company is technically insolvent on a book basis and D/E loses meaning entirely.
  • MistakeMixing book equity with market debt.
    FixPick one regime and stick to it. Book values come from the balance sheet; market values use share price × shares outstanding for equity and traded prices for bonds. Mixing them produces ratios that don't reconcile to any reported figure.

Frequently asked questions

What is a good debt-to-equity ratio?

It depends heavily on industry. Generally, below 1.0 is considered conservative and 1.0-2.0 is moderate. Tech companies often run 0.1-0.5, utilities 1.5-2.5, and banks 5-10. The right anchor is the industry median, not an absolute number.

Is a high D/E ratio always bad?

Not necessarily. Debt is cheaper than equity because interest is tax-deductible. If a company can earn more on borrowed money than the interest cost, leverage increases shareholder returns. The concern is fragility — high D/E magnifies losses in downturns and raises default risk.

What's included in total liabilities?

Everything on the liability side of the balance sheet: short-term debt, long-term debt, bonds payable, lease obligations, accounts payable, accrued expenses, deferred taxes, and pension liabilities. Some analysts strip out non-interest-bearing items like accounts payable for a 'financial debt' variant.

How is D/E different from the debt-to-assets ratio?

D/E divides debt by equity; debt-to-assets divides debt by total assets. They're algebraically related: Debt/Assets = D/E ÷ (1 + D/E). A D/E of 1.0 equals a 50% debt ratio. D/E shows the mix between financing sources; debt ratio shows what share of assets is debt-funded.

Should I use book equity or market equity?

Book equity (from the 10-K balance sheet) is the standard for credit and accounting work. Market equity (share price × shares outstanding) is more relevant for investors and is used in market-value capital structure analysis. Market-based D/E is usually lower for healthy firms because market cap exceeds book value.

Does the calculator include preferred stock?

Shareholders' equity on the balance sheet typically includes both common and preferred equity. Some analysts treat preferred as debt-like (because of its fixed dividend), which would move it from the denominator into the numerator. If you want that variant, add the preferred-stock balance to Total Liabilities.

What does an equity multiplier of 5x mean?

It means total assets are five times shareholders' equity, so the company is using $4 of liabilities for every $1 of equity to fund its asset base. Equity multiplier is part of the DuPont decomposition of return on equity, where ROE = Net Margin × Asset Turnover × Equity Multiplier.

Can D/E be negative?

Yes, when shareholders' equity is negative because cumulative losses or buybacks exceed paid-in capital. Examples include some highly leveraged buyouts and companies in distress. A negative ratio doesn't mean the company is safe — it usually signals the opposite, and the metric stops being interpretable.

How often should D/E be recalculated?

At least each quarter when new 10-Q filings drop, and any time the capital structure changes — debt issuance, buybacks, large dividends, or major write-downs. Trend over multiple quarters is more informative than a single snapshot.

Where can I find total debt and equity for a public company?

Read the balance sheet in the latest 10-K (annual) or 10-Q (quarterly) filing on SEC EDGAR. Total liabilities and total stockholders' equity are reported subtotals. For private companies, use audited financial statements; for benchmarking, NYU Damodaran publishes industry averages.
